William J. Rogers is a scholar working on Materials Chemistry, Mechanics of Materials and Aerospace Engineering. According to data from OpenAlex, William J. Rogers has authored 37 papers receiving a total of 787 indexed citations (citations by other indexed papers that have themselves been cited), including 18 papers in Materials Chemistry, 16 papers in Mechanics of Materials and 10 papers in Aerospace Engineering. Recurrent topics in William J. Rogers’s work include Thermal and Kinetic Analysis (18 papers), Energetic Materials and Combustion (16 papers) and Combustion and Detonation Processes (10 papers). William J. Rogers is often cited by papers focused on Thermal and Kinetic Analysis (18 papers), Energetic Materials and Combustion (16 papers) and Combustion and Detonation Processes (10 papers). William J. Rogers collaborates with scholars based in United States, Greece and Norway. William J. Rogers's co-authors include M. Sam Mannan, Qingsheng Wang, Fuman Zhao, R. R. Davison, Hans J. Pasman, J A Bullin, Philip Hodge, Charles R. Harrison, Michael B. Hall and Lisa M. Pérez and has published in prestigious journals such as Journal of Bone and Joint Surgery, Journal of Hazardous Materials and CHEST Journal.
